There is no limit in saving energy when you have to, i.e. when you don't have much of it. You have propane to make a dinner, AA battery LED lights, and if it's not freezing in trailer before you go to sleep, you don't need any 12V power. Consider a catalytic heater, in your situation this is an investment well worth it, will save both AH and propane for hot shower. With a whole 140 AH bank, this is 70 AH usable, more than you need for 5 days with cat heater.
Here is a recent portable setup of 2*50W panels hinged together, propped on pieces of conduit. Doesn't cost much. One 100W might be cheaper, but 2*50 is easier to store. As it's been said, you only need a thin #10 cable from panel to controller. People use landscaping cable if panels didn't come with MC4 plugs, otherwise you have to buy MC4 extension cable #10 and cut it in half, it comes in up to 100ft length. And a red-black booster cable #8 with crocodiles from controller to batteries - like the one that you have in your truck, cut the crocodiles off on the controller end.
